ain't it the truth .... I well remember the days when a car reached 80,000 miles the motor was gone .... the body was usually still good but motor was used up .... now its hard to find a used car for sale with less than a 100,000 miles on it

Many of our company cars and truck rack up 250-350 K on them ,and still run good when we turn them in. Friend of mine has a 2000 Ford Tarsus258,000 on it last week no major repairs. Son runs up a lot if miles in a short time has 160,000 on his ford focus still runs like a new car.
It has been almost 20 years sense we worried about cars starting in the cold. Last winter we had week long 20 below weather not one failed to start.
Did have to get Mother in law a new battery today hers was the factory one in her 2009. It failed this morning at 2 below. She said it had been getting weak. I reminded her she needs to tell me soon as she thinks there is a problem not wait until it fails.
